Key AI Tools Every Orlando Home Service Business Should Consider
1. Conversational AI for 24/7 Customer Service
Imagine a homeowner in Winter Park needing urgent AC repair at midnight. A well‑trained chatbot can collect essential details (unit type, problem description, address) and even schedule a technician—all without a human on call. Platforms such as ManyChat or Dialogflow integrate with your website and CRM, providing:
- Instant response times (average < 30 seconds)
- Lead capture that feeds directly into your scheduling software
- Reduced need for a full‑time receptionist, saving up to $30,000 per year for a midsize business
2. Predictive Lead Scoring
Not every inbound request will convert. Predictive lead scoring uses historical data—service type, location, time of day, and even weather patterns—to assign a probability of conversion. For example, an AI consultant can build a model that shows a 70% conversion likelihood for pest‑control calls made during the humid summer months in Altamonte Springs, prompting a higher bidding strategy for those ads.
3. Automated Content Creation
Local SEO remains vital for home service businesses, but producing fresh blog posts, service pages, and Google Business updates can be tedious. Tools like Jasper AI or Copy.ai generate optimized copy in minutes. When paired with a human editor, you get high‑quality, keyword‑rich content without the writer’s hourly rate.
4. Dynamic Ad Bidding & Budget Allocation
Google’s Smart Bidding and Facebook’s Automated Rules already use AI, but a custom business automation layer can go further. By feeding real‑time ROI data back into ad platforms, the system can:
- Pause under‑performing ads during rainy days when HVAC calls drop
- Boost spend on sewer‑line repair ads during the rainy season in Kissimmee, where demand spikes 40%
- Adjust geographic targeting according to neighborhood income levels, ensuring you bid more aggressively in higher‑value zip codes like 32801
Practical Steps to Implement AI Marketing in Orlando
Step 1 – Audit Your Current Marketing Stack
Start by mapping out every tool you currently use—website CMS, email platform, CRM, ad accounts, and phone system. Identify gaps where manual effort dominates, such as:
- Manual entry of phone calls into the CRM
- Weekly spreadsheet updates for ad performance
- Ad‑hoc email follow‑ups after a service call
Step 2 – Choose an AI‑Ready CRM
Platforms like HubSpot, Zoho CRM, and ServiceTitan now include AI modules for lead scoring, email sequencing, and pipeline forecasting. Integrate these with your existing phone system (e.g., RingCentral) so every call automatically creates a record and a follow‑up task.
Step 3 – Deploy a Conversational Bot on Your Site
Use a low‑code builder to create a bot that asks three key questions:
- What service do you need?
- When would you like it performed?
- What is your address?
Connect the bot to your calendar API so it can book real‑time slots. Test the flow on a small landing page first, then roll it out site‑wide once you see a cost savings increase in qualified leads.
Step 4 – Automate Content Distribution
Set up a workflow that pulls newly generated blog posts (via AI copywriting) into a scheduling tool like Buffer or Hootsuite. Include local keywords such as “Orlando AC repair” or “Winter Park pest control” to improve local SEO. Schedule posts for peak engagement times—typically early evenings on weekdays for homeowners.
Step 5 – Monitor, Optimize, and Scale
Use a dashboard (Google Data Studio, Power BI, or HubSpot’s native reporting) to track key metrics:
- Cost per lead (CPL)
- Conversion rate from chatbot to scheduled service
- Return on ad spend (ROAS) after AI‑driven bid adjustments
- Average time saved per employee due to automation
Reallocate any budget saved toward higher‑margin services—like whole‑home HVAC upgrades—once the AI system stabilizes.

Actionable Tips for Immediate Implementation
- Start small: Deploy a chatbot on a single service page (e.g., “Drain Cleaning Orlando”) and measure conversion before expanding.
- Leverage free data sources: Use the National Weather Service API to feed humidity and temperature data into your predictive lead model.
- Use AI‑generated ad copy as A/B test variations: Run two versions of a Facebook ad—one human‑written, one AI‑generated—and let the platform decide the winner.
- Set clear automation rules: Define a maximum daily ad spend and a minimum ROAS threshold; the AI will pause campaigns that don’t meet targets.
- Educate your team: Hold a 30‑minute workshop so field technicians understand how AI‑generated follow‑up emails will reference their work, improving customer trust.
